What is the cheapest month to fly from Honolulu to Maryland?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Honolulu to Maryland,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Honolulu to Maryland is October, when tickets cost $579 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are December and March, when the average cost of round-trip tickets is $871 and $842 respectively.

What’s the cheapest day of the week to fly from Honolulu to Maryland?

The average price of all round-trip flights from Honolulu to Maryland clicked on KAYAK for each day over the last 12 months.

When flying from Honolulu to Maryland, you should consider leaving on a Wednesday and avoid Saturdays if you are looking for the best rates. For your return to Honolulu, you’ll find the best rates on Wednesdays and the most expensive ones on Sundays.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Honolulu to Maryland?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ights from Honolulu to Maryland,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.

To get a below average price on the flight from Honolulu to Maryland, you should book around 1 week before departure.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 20 weeks before departure.
